The Washtenaw Voice wins 30 awards

5 first place honors received, including general excellence 

Some of the 2024-2025 scholarship team posing with awards after the ceremony. (Top row, from left to right) Alice McGuire, Beck Elandt, Jada Hauser, Zeinab Agbaria and Yana McGuire. (Bottom row, from left to right) Lily Cole, Courtney Prielipp and Natalie Kyle. Lilly Kujawski | The Washtenaw Voice 

Alice McGuire | Deputy Editor 

On April 5, members of the Voice staff traveled to Central Michigan University to represent Washtenaw Community College as they partook in the annual Michigan Community College Press Association Conference (MCCPA) awards ceremony, where they were granted 30 awards. Among them was first place in General Excellence for the newspaper as a whole.

Students from across the state gathered for a day of networking, critique and a variety of panels on subjects ranging from writing to photography, featuring speakers such as Adam Graham, reporter and film critic for The Detroit News. The event ended with the awards ceremony.
